Clare Restauranteurs Debate Return To Indoor Dining

Could July 26th be the day that you get to return to an inside table in restaurants and pubs across County Clare?

Hospitality industry representatives met with senior government officials yesterday afternoon in a bid to find a pathway back to the return of indoor dining.

The Government is looking to pass new legislation in the next week on allowing only vaccinated people to eat inside restaurants.

The Cabinet will consider six reopening options when it meets on Tuesday, after talks were held with hospitality representatives yesterday.

The proposals include a system that allows only vaccinated people and those recovered from Covid indoors, a system which has been operating successfully in many other EU countries.

But how will these new proposals work in practice?

On Friday’s Morning Focus Alan Morrisey spoke to Brian O’ Neill MD of the Rowan Tree in Ennis and Patrick O’Donoghue, one of the owners of Monks Restaurant, The Pier, Ballyvaughan.
